Self-propelled pallet wrappers are increasingly becoming a staple in manufacturing and packaging industries, revolutionizing the way products are wrapped and prepared for shipment. These machines are designed to automate the wrapping process, providing significant advantages over traditional hand-wrapping methods. Understanding the functionality and benefits of self-propelled pallet wrappers can help you make informed decisions for your packaging operations.
One of the primary advantages of self-propelled pallet wrappers is their efficiency. These machines are capable of wrapping pallets with stretch film quickly and consistently, reducing the time required for the wrapping process. Unlike manual wrapping, which can be labor-intensive and inconsistent, self-propelled wrappers maintain uniform tension and coverage, ensuring that each pallet is securely wrapped. This not only improves the protection of products during transit but also minimizes the risk of damage.
Another key benefit is the reduction in labor costs. With the automation that self-propelled pallet wrappers provide, fewer personnel are required to manage the wrapping process. This allows your workforce to focus on more critical tasks, ultimately enhancing overall productivity. Additionally, since the machine can be operated by a single individual, it streamlines operations and reduces the need for multiple workers in packaging roles.
Self-propelled pallet wrappers are also designed for versatility. They can handle various pallet sizes and weights, making them suitable for a wide range of products, from small boxes to large industrial items. Many models come equipped with adjustable settings, allowing users to customize the wrapping process according to specific needs. This flexibility ensures that you can package a diverse array of products without the need for multiple machines.
Moreover, these machines contribute to sustainability efforts. By using stretch film more efficiently, self-propelled pallet wrappers help reduce material waste. With precise wrapping techniques, less film is needed to secure the product, leading to lower costs and a smaller environmental footprint. This aspect can be particularly appealing for businesses that prioritize eco-friendly practices.
In terms of safety, self-propelled pallet wrappers enhance workplace safety by minimizing the risks associated with manual handling. The machine's design allows for safe and controlled wrapping, reducing the likelihood of workplace injuries related to lifting and straining.
In conclusion, self-propelled pallet wrappers offer a multitude of benefits, from increased efficiency and reduced labor costs to enhanced safety and sustainability. Investing in these machines can significantly improve your packaging operations, providing a streamlined solution that meets the demands of modern manufacturing and logistics. By understanding the capabilities of self-propelled pallet wrappers, you can make informed choices that enhance productivity and ensure the secure delivery of your products.
